Two sin‑bins, a whopping 33 penalties, a player on report, two key personnel missing for the Cronulla Sharks and they still managed an upset win over NRL defending champions Melbourne Storm 14‑4 last night.

It turned out to be a very Good Friday for the Sharks.

It was their first win at home for 2018 as they broke even for the season ‑ two wins and two losses.

 

Meanwhile, the Rabbitohs beat the Bulldogs 20-16 while the Panthers continued their dominant performance as they defeated the Cowboys 33-14.
